Haliburton Snowdon Park Wetland Preserve

Brenda Ann Chambers Trail

Directions: The entrance to the park is off County Rd 1, just 0.3 km south of the County Rd 1 / South Lake Rd. (Country Road 16) intersection. Then drive 0.7 km west of County Road 1 along the entrance roadway.
Length: 3 km loop
Difficulty: easy, wheelchair accessible

Description: Located about 20-minutes south of haliburton Village on Gelert Road (the former County Road 1), Snowdon Park is a wonderful place to spot the tracks of deer, fisher, otter, fox, and perhaps – and if you’re lucky – the animals themselves. The terrain is primarily flat, with several short, side trails and loops traversing through a swamp, fen complex, wetlands and hardwood forest. A portion of the trail is wheelchair accessible and leads to a platform which overlooks a shallow, open-water marsh. 

Snowdon Park's self-guided trail of about 3 km is quite level and an easy walk and winds through an upland mixed forest and presents excellent examples of wetlands, from a shallow open water marsh, adjacent to a viewing platform to a large fen complex and a hardwood forest swamp. The platform is a lovely spot to be just before sunset, because the sun sets on the far side of the marsh making for lovely photo ops. This also applies during the Winter months, too.

Watch for birds such as Ravens, Gray Jays, Blue jays, Nuthatches, wild Turkeys, various species of Woodpeckers and Chickadees.

Winter Green Maple Syrup Barn

Just a short hop further down County Road 1 on the right-hand side is Wintergreen Maple Syrup Barn. If you enjoy pancakes, you won't want to miss their all-day breakfast. You will also enjoy barbecue hot dogs and hamburgers grilled outside. Lining the many shelves inside are dozens of jars of preserves, jams and jellies made from blueberry, raspberry maple syrups, strawberrys and many other flavours. During the summer they are open 7 days a week, and at other times of the year they have strawberry and blueberry socials, and weekly jazz and blues sessions. Haliburton Outdoors Association Fish Hatchery

The Fish Hatchery is a couple of kms down Gelert Road, at the traffic light by the CF-100 jet mounted on the petisal. Drop in and have a look at the indoor breeding tanks containing lake trout,  and the famous relic from the last ice age, the Haliburton Gold Trout which cannot be found anywhere else in the World!
